Your electric fireplace is making a clicking noise when the temperature in the room goes above and below the thermostat. What is that thing? An electric fireplace can make a clicking noise as the metal components expand and contract as it warms up and cools down.
Why is my fireplace making a clicking noise?
It’s not unusual to hear popping and clicking in the first few minutes after a fireplace is turned on. The metal components expand as they warm up, and should disappear in a few minutes.

Why is my gas fireplace making a chirping noise?
This is a signal from the receiver box to let you know that the batteries need to be changed.
